Ronald G. Goulet, 91 of Worcester, loving father, grandfather and great grandfather, passed peacefully at home on March 17, 2025, surrounded by his loving family.

Ron was born on May 25, 1933, in Worcester, one of two sons of the late Arthur J. and Kathleen B. (Galvin) Goulet. He attended Worcester Public Schools, and was a graduate of Commerce High School, class of 1952. He later earned his associates degree from Worcester Junior College. Ron spent his professional career as a purchasing agent and buyer for various local manufacturing companies before retiring from Acumeter Laboratories. He was a member of St. Stephen’s Church and the Knights of Columbus Pope John XXIII, where he earned the distinct honor of Fourth Degree Knight.

Ron was a man who always carried a song in his heart and on the tip of his tongue. Music was part of who he was. His joyful spirit and love of life were infectious, and he always knew how to brighten any room with a song. He was a true hopeless romantic and shared so many songs with lyrics that held true meaning, and he never forgot to remind you of his Irish heritage.

Ron had many passions. He was a sports enthusiast, avid cribbage player, enjoyed bowling, sharing his famous basketball moves, sports stories and singing old time music. He always found the good in everyone and every situation. He took pride in his family and tried to be involved in everything they did. You could find him in the stands or right field, coaching along the games. He enjoyed his daily visits to Friendly’s on Grafton St and was doted on by the staff. He enjoyed Sunday drives, recent summers in Hull, and sharing stories of growing up on Grafton Hill with his buddies.
